How much do mid level full stack develop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 22, 2026, the average hourly pay for mid level full stack developer in New Jersey is $60.16,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$50.05 and $69.33 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a mid level full stack developer?

A Mid Level Full Stack Developer is responsible for developing and maintaining both front-end and back-end components of web applications. They have a solid understanding of programming languages, frameworks, databases, and server-side logic. Typically, they collaborate with designers, other developers, and stakeholders to implement features and optimize performance. With a few years of experience, they can work independently on tasks while contributing to project architecture and problem-solving.

What does a mid level full stack developer do?

As a Mid Level Full Stack Developer, you’ll typically work on both client-facing and server-side components of web applications, collaborating closely with UX/UI designers, backend engineers, and product managers. You may be responsible for creating new features, debugging complex issues, optimizing application performance, and maintaining codebases. It's common to participate in code reviews and Agile sprints, ensuring best practices are followed throughout the development cycle. This role provides exposure to a wide range of technologies and business needs, offering strong opportunities for learning and career advancement as you take on more complex assignments.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a mid level full stack developer?

To thrive as a Mid Level Full Stack Developer, you need a solid understanding of front-end and back-end development, proficiency in programming languages like JavaScript, Python, or Java, and experience with frameworks such as React and Node.js.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, cloud platforms (e.g., AWS or Azure), and relevant certifications such as AWS Certified Developer can be advantageous. Strong problem-solving skills, effective communication, and the ability to work collaboratively set outstanding candidates apart. These skills and qualities are essential for building scalable applications and navigating the dynamic requirements of cross-functional development teams.

Is a mid level full stack developer still in demand?

Mid level full stack developers are currently in demand due to their versatility in working with both front-end and back-end technologies like JavaScript, React, Node.js, and databases. Employers seek these developers for their ability to contribute across project phases, and experience with cloud platforms and version control tools enhances job prospects.
